The UKTI International Music and Interactive Events Roadshow

13 August 2014

UKTI are launching a series of international music and interactive roadshow events in the run up to some upcoming major music conferences including Eurosonic, SXSW, LSC, The Great Escape and Midem. If you’re interested in developing your business / career, gaining first-hand knowledge and insight into some of the world’s biggest and most influential trade and showcase events, find out more on how to attend below.

Guest speakers include Una Johnston (SXSW), Javier Lopez (MIDEM) , Phil Patterson (UKTI) and guests from UKTI overseas plus various trade associations and collection societies.

The event will include short presentations from representatives of each event before the session into a general Q&A session, followed by networking which will give artists and businesses a chance to discuss attendance in depth with the experts.

  • Discover how UK Trade & Investment can help develop your business internationally
  • Find out about conferencing events and which events are right for you
  • Learn how to showcase your music, artists and business
  • Dos and Don’ts – Make the most of your time at events
  • Find out about available funding and support
  • Meet industry trade associations and collection societies
